Home
Results for: pyrenoid
Dictionary (1 of 3 sources) Open/Close data Source
py·re·noid (pī-rē'noid', pī'rə-)
n.
A proteinaceous structure found within the chloroplast of certain algae and bryophytes. It is considered to be associated with starch deposition.

[New Latin pȳrēna, fruit stone; see pyrene + -OID.]




Wikipedia Open/Close data Source
Mentioned In Open/Close data Source